Does Not Live Up to Promises & Way Over Priced

From: DJetta78
Date posted: 2/21/2006
Years at this apartment: 2005 - 2006
 
My husband and I moved into Northwoods in August 2005. We live in a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om unit that takes pets. All seemed great at first, however the honeymoon ended after a few months.

People do not pick up after their pets, the dog walk is rocky and has deep holes in it...so deep the water drainage pipes show underground, don't even try going down after dark. Pet owners do not care and let their animals urinate right on the building, air conditioning units and sidewalks. When we told management, their reply was to find out who it was...yeah like I have the time to be a P.I.

Anyway, winter came around and they do a lousy job of cleaning the parking lot and walkways...they hardly put any salt or sand down and forget if you want to get to your car, they don't shovel the walks to your car. It was so bad, my neighbor was walking her dog, slipped and fell and now has a metal rod in her arm that broke! and still they do not shovel the walks. There is hardly no parking, we always have to park in what we call the pit.

The tile in the bathroom is falling off the wall, the bathroom fan makes this outrageous noise, our toilet handle has broken twice, I ended up fixing it...maintainence is ridiculous, they ride around in golf carts and almost ran my husband and 2 small dogs over without even slowing down. Our bedroom doesn't get warm, even with the heat on 75....we had to buy a little heater.

Another thing with this place is what I refer to as a revolving door condo. People move in and out so darn quick, don't even bother talking to your neighbors, they'll be gone in a few weeks. Ours moved out in the middle of the night and we had new ones five days later! It's like a factory.

The bottom line is, this place seems great in the beginning, but beware, they charge way too much and don't deliver anything but empty promises. Needless to say we're breaking our lease and moving out in March.
